How old do you have to be to rent a car in Cedarville?
If you’re 21 and above, you can hire a vehicle in Cedarville. Take note that most rental suppliers will charge an additional fee if you’re a young driver, which is meant to cover the higher accident risk involved. Also, young motorists are often restricted from hiring larger or luxury models of cars. Carefully read the fine print before booking to avoid any surprises at pick-up.
What do you need to rent a car in Cedarville?
You’ll need to present a valid driver’s license and a credit card in your name when you get to the hire counter. Before pick-up, check with your selected hire company whether anything else is needed. For example, you may also need to provide proof of auto insurance.

Can I drive in Cedarville with my current driver's license?
If you don’t have a driver’s license issued in the U.S, you might need to apply for an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country before hiring a car. If you find that an IDP is part of the requirements to drive in the U.S., be aware that you’ll also have to show your current driver’s license and your passport or other forms of identification. Lastly, the credit card used to hire the car needs to match the name on your license and passport in order to finalize your car hire. Additional requirements for hire cars in the U.S. Are:

  • Age restrictions: You must be at least 25 in most states to be able to hire a car, although in some places, the minimum age is 21 years. We recommend checking state and local regulations, as well as with the company you’re hiring from before you go to understand all the regulations that may apply to you.
  •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before you get behind the wheel so you can avoid unnecessary fees. When hiring a car in the U.S, you usually can’t cross country borders into Canada or Mexico, use car ferries or traverse rough terrain with a hire car. Please read the details before you book!
